The playful duck quack evolved into a meme sound for silly reactions, awkward moments, and random humor. Frequently used in viral edits when something unexpected happens in a cute or ironic way, making it popular across reaction audio and internet culture jokes.
The "Rubber Duckie Quack" sound is exactly what it sounds like: a playful, often exaggerated quack of a rubber duck. Its meme status comes from its versatility as a reaction sound, capable of conveying everything from innocent confusion to ironic commentary. It's a sound that instantly evokes a sense of silliness and lightheartedness, making it perfect for moments that are awkward, cute, or unexpectedly funny. The sound's simple yet effective nature allows it to transcend language barriers, becoming a universally recognized symbol of playful absurdity. Its charm lies in its ability to instantly defuse tension or add a layer of whimsical humor to any situation, much like the unexpected charm of fnaf yay or the simple yet impactful Wow sound.
